#include "sitesController.h"
#include <QFile>
#include <QHostInfo>
#include <QStandardPaths>
#include "systemController.h"
#include "core/networkUtilities.h"
SitesController::SitesController(const std::shared_ptr<Settings> &settings,
const QSharedPointer<VpnConnection> &vpnConnection,
const QSharedPointer<SitesModel> &sitesModel, QObject *parent)
: QObject(parent), m_settings(settings), m_vpnConnection(vpnConnection), m_sitesModel(sitesModel)
{
}
void SitesController::addSite(QString hostname)
{
if (hostname.isEmpty()) {
return;
}
if (!hostname.contains(".")) {
emit errorOccurred(tr("Hostname not look like ip adress or domain name"));
return;
}
if (!NetworkUtilities::ipAddressWithSubnetRegExp().exactMatch(hostname)) {
// get domain name if it present
hostname.replace("https://", "");
hostname.replace("http://", "");
hostname.replace("ftp://", "");
hostname = hostname.split("/", Qt::SkipEmptyParts).first();
}
const auto &processSite = [this](const QString &hostname, const QString &ip) {
m_sitesModel->addSite(hostname, ip);
if (!ip.isEmpty()) {
QMetaObject::invokeMethod(m_vpnConnection.get(), "addRoutes", Qt::QueuedConnection,
Q_ARG(QStringList, QStringList() << ip));
} else if (NetworkUtilities::ipAddressWithSubnetRegExp().exactMatch(hostname)) {
QMetaObject::invokeMethod(m_vpnConnection.get(), "addRoutes", Qt::QueuedConnection,
Q_ARG(QStringList, QStringList() << hostname));
}
};
const auto &resolveCallback = [this, processSite](const QHostInfo &hostInfo) {
const QList<QHostAddress> &addresses = hostInfo.addresses();
for (const QHostAddress &addr : hostInfo.addresses()) {
if (addr.protocol() == QAbstractSocket::NetworkLayerProtocol::IPv4Protocol) {
processSite(hostInfo.hostName(), addr.toString());
break;
}
}
};
if (NetworkUtilities::ipAddressWithSubnetRegExp().exactMatch(hostname)) {
processSite(hostname, "");
} else {
processSite(hostname, "");
QHostInfo::lookupHost(hostname, this, resolveCallback);
}
emit finished(tr("New site added: %1").arg(hostname));
}
void SitesController::removeSite(int index)
{
auto modelIndex = m_sitesModel->index(index);
auto hostname = m_sitesModel->data(modelIndex, SitesModel::Roles::UrlRole).toString();
m_sitesModel->removeSite(modelIndex);
QMetaObject::invokeMethod(m_vpnConnection.get(), "deleteRoutes", Qt::QueuedConnection,
Q_ARG(QStringList, QStringList() << hostname));
emit finished(tr("Site removed: %1").arg(hostname));
}
void SitesController::importSites(const QString &fileName, bool replaceExisting)
{
QByteArray jsonData;
if (!SystemController::readFile(fileName, jsonData)) {
emit errorOccurred(tr("Can't open file: %1").arg(fileName));
return;
}
QJsonDocument jsonDocument = QJsonDocument::fromJson(jsonData);
if (jsonDocument.isNull()) {
emit errorOccurred(tr("Failed to parse JSON data from file: %1").arg(fileName));
return;
}
if (!jsonDocument.isArray()) {
emit errorOccurred(tr("The JSON data is not an array in file: %1").arg(fileName));
return;
}
auto jsonArray = jsonDocument.array();
QMap<QString, QString> sites;
QStringList ips;
for (auto jsonValue : jsonArray) {
auto jsonObject = jsonValue.toObject();
auto hostname = jsonObject.value("hostname").toString("");
auto ip = jsonObject.value("ip").toString("");
if (!hostname.contains(".") && !NetworkUtilities::ipAddressWithSubnetRegExp().exactMatch(hostname)) {
qDebug() << hostname << " not look like ip adress or domain name";
continue;
}
if (ip.isEmpty()) {
ips.append(hostname);
} else {
ips.append(ip);
}
sites.insert(hostname, ip);
}
m_sitesModel->addSites(sites, replaceExisting);
QMetaObject::invokeMethod(m_vpnConnection.get(), "addRoutes", Qt::QueuedConnection, Q_ARG(QStringList, ips));
emit finished(tr("Import completed"));
}
void SitesController::exportSites(const QString &fileName)
{
auto sites = m_sitesModel->getCurrentSites();
QJsonArray jsonArray;
for (const auto &site : sites) {
QJsonObject jsonObject { { "hostname", site.first }, { "ip", site.second } };
jsonArray.append(jsonObject);
}
QJsonDocument jsonDocument(jsonArray);
QByteArray jsonData = jsonDocument.toJson();
SystemController::saveFile(fileName, jsonData);
emit finished(tr("Export completed"));
}
